Our condominium is thoroughly renovated and superbly equipped with premier quality furniture, linens, and kitchen ware. Features include granite kitchen counter tops, hardwood floors, and original black & white photography. There are six units in the historic 1903 Territorial style complex (3 buildings).
The kitchen has a full assortment of dinnerware, cooking utensils, and condiments for cooking. Excellent local restaurants include Snooze, Work & Class, Piattis and Hillstone (both in Cherry Creek Shopping area). Also see guest book for restaurants recommended by guests.

Each unit has a back deck leading into a common garden area. The decks and common area are enclosed with gates and a 6 foot security fence.
You are four blocks from the Denver light rail, which can take you downtown, to a good portion of the rest of the city including directly to the convention center.
The area is designated a historic district and is the oldest existing neighborhood in Denver. Extensive renovations of Victorian era property are taking place in the area as well as new town home and condominium projects.
There is ample safe parking on the street in front of the unit or on the side street.
We leave two hybrid commuter bikes with helmets at the unit. This is a superb means of transportation including exploring this historic part of Denver. There are numerous bike trails throughout the city.
